Korean
Etymology
Sino-Korean word from 부(不) (bu, “not”) + 자유(自由) (jayu, “freedom”). See also Japanese 不自由 (fujiyū).

Noun
부자유 • (bujayu) (hanja 不自由)
- restriction, lack of freedom
- Antonym: 자유(自由) (jayu, “freedom, liberty”)
